A Taste of History: Chinese Culinary Roots in Atlanta

The story of Chinese food in Atlanta is intertwined with the history of Chinese immigration to the United States. While early Chinese immigrants faced significant discrimination and hardship, they gradually established communities and businesses, including restaurants that introduced Americans to the flavors of their homeland. These early restaurants often adapted their menus to cater to American tastes, leading to the development of dishes like chop suey and General Tso’s chicken, which, while popular, sometimes overshadow the authentic regional cuisines of China.

Over time, as immigration patterns shifted and culinary trends evolved, Atlanta’s Chinese food scene began to diversify. More recent waves of immigrants from different regions of China brought with them their unique culinary traditions, resulting in a wider variety of restaurants that showcase the authentic flavors of Sichuan, Cantonese, Hunan, and other regional cuisines. The restaurants on Moreland Avenue represent this evolution, offering a mix of familiar favorites and more adventurous dishes that reflect the true diversity of Chinese food.
